French Beauty Style Skincare: Less Products, More Radiance

French Beauty Style begins with great skin. French women prioritize hydration and simplicity over heavy routines. My go-to skincare includes:

  • Bioderma Sensibio H2O Micellar Water
  • Avène Thermal Spring Water Spray
  • Embryolisse Lait-Crème Concentré
  • La Roche-Posay Anthelios SPF

Real-life Example: On a 7-day trip to Paris, I used only these 4 items. My skin stayed dewy, calm, and perfectly prepped for minimal makeup.

Best Tip: Pack double-duty items (e.g., moisturizer as primer) to save space and simplify your routine.

French Beauty Style Makeup: 5 Products for the Perfect Look

Makeup in French Beauty Style is about enhancing not hiding. Choose multi-use and cream-based products.

  • Tinted Moisturizer
  • Cream Blush (that doubles as lipstick)
  • Mascara
  • Eyebrow Pencil
  • Red Lipstick

Real-life Example: In Nice, I had 10 minutes to get ready for dinner. I used only these five items and looked polished and photo-ready.

Best Tip: Use products that blend with your fingers. Less tools = less clutter.

French Beauty Style Wardrobe: The 10-Piece Carry-On Capsule

Neutral tones, luxurious textures, and perfect fits define French fashion. My carry-on capsule:

  • 1 Blazer
  • 2 Pants
  • 1 Jeans
  • 1 Dress
  • 2 Tops
  • 1 Skirt
  • 1 Sweater
  • 1 Trench Coat

Real-life Example: In Provence, I mixed and matched these pieces for city strolls, museum visits, and evening wine tastings.

Best Tip: Stick to a neutral color palette (black, navy, beige, white). Everything will pair easily.

French Beauty Style Shoes: Two Pairs, Maximum Style

Comfort and elegance go hand in hand. You only need:

  • One pair of loafers or chic sneakers
  • One pair of block-heeled sandals or ballet flats

Real-life Example: I wore leather loafers across Paris with zero foot pain and paired sandals with a dress in Monaco.

Best Tip: Choose footwear that works day and night. Invest in quality materials.

French Beauty Style Accessories: Elevate the Simple

Accessories make your outfit personal. Keep it minimal but meaningful:

  • Silk Scarf
  • Gold Hoop Earrings
  • Leather Belt
  • Structured Bag

Real-life Example: In Bordeaux, a scarf tied to my handbag completely elevated a jeans-and-tee look.

Best Tip: Pack accessories that can shift looks from casual to chic with zero effort.

French Beauty Style Packing Technique: Organized and Intentional

Don’t just throw things in a bag. Fold, roll, and categorize like a pro.

Real-life Example: In Marseille, using packing cubes saved me time and kept outfits crisp.

Best Tip: Fold bulkier items flat, roll soft garments, and separate shoes in dust bags.

French Beauty Style Fragrance: Scent as Signature

A subtle scent completes your look. Travel with:

  • Diptyque Eau Rose (travel spray)
  • Chanel L’Eau No.5 (mini size)

Real-life Example: In a café in Cannes, someone complimented my perfume. It was the only thing I “wore” that day besides sunscreen.

Best Tip: Spray fragrance on scarf ends or your collarbone for lasting impact.
